Morgan, Richard Williams (1815-1889)
Llangynfelin. Curate
'Môr Meibion'
b. Llancynfelin.
Curate in Mochdre, Tregynon and England.
Publications
Amddiffyniad yr Iaith Gymraeg, Caernarfon : H. Humphreys, W. Hughes, 1858. 52 t.
Brief historical memoir of the Herberts, formerly of Raglan and Tretower, Siluria, now of Powys Castle, Powys , n.d.
British Kymry of Britons of Cambria, Ruthin and London, 1857
Christianity and Modern Infidelity, London, 1854. 2nd ed. New York, 1859
Church and its Episcopal Corruptions in Wales, 1st ed. 1855, 2nd ed with important additions, 1855
Churches of England and Wales, n.d.
Correspondence and Statements of Facts, London : R. Hardwicke, 1855. 40 p.
Correspondence between his grace the Archbishop OF Canterbury and R.W. Morgan, London : R. Hardwicke, 1855. 24 p.
Duke's Daughter, a classic tragedy (in verse), London, 1867
Hanes yr hen Gymry. Cyf gan Ab Ithel, Rhuthin : I. Clarke, 1858. Arg. Arall Efrog Newydd, 1860
History of Britain from the flood to A.D. 700 – being a reprint of the first part of the British Kymry of 1857, London, 1933
Ida de Galis. A tragedy of Powys Castle, London : Bateman and Hardwicke, 1851
Maynooth and St Asaph, London, 1848
North Wales or Vendotia, London : 1856
Notes on the various distinctive Verities of the Christian Church London : Rimington, 1849
Raymonde de Monthault, the Lord Marcher. 3 v London, 1853
St. Paul in Britain or the Origin of the British as opposed to Papal Christianity Oxford and London : Parker, 1861 2nd ed. 1880. 6th ed. 1930 London : Covenant Publishing Co., viii, 192 p.
Saints in Britain, n.d.
Scheme for the Reconstruction of the Church Episcopate and its patronage to Wales, London : Hardwicke, 1855. 58 p.
Vindication of the Church of England, London : Rimington, 1851
Vindication of Mosaic ethnology of Europe, London, 1863
